JSON扫盲帖 JSON.as类教程

_相关内容

如何对JSON类型进行高效分析

31))*(CAST JSON_EXTRACT(produce.attributes,"$.delivery.height")/JSON as DOUBLE(38,31))*(CAST JSON_EXTRACT(produce.attributes,"$.delivery.weight")/JSON as DOUBLE(38,31))>1000.000000)在千万级produce表普通列 PolarDB 行列存...

CAST

示例用法如下:cast(json as string):将JSON表达式转换为STRING类型。JSON表达式要求为非ARRAY和OBJECT类型。cast(string as json):将STRING类型值转换为JSON表达式,JSON表达式的类型为STRING。注意其与json_parse和json_format的区别,...

CAST函数

例如,将VARCHAR类型的数据[1,2,3]先转换为JSON类型,再转换为SMALLINT类型,语句如下:SELECT CAST(CAST('[1,2,3]' AS JSON)AS SMALLINT);返回错误如下:ERROR 1815(HY000):[20034,2021091814103119216818804803453190138]:Cannot cast ...

复杂类型函数

您可以在MaxCompute SQL中使用复杂类型函数处理复杂数据类型,例如ARRAY、MAP、STRUCT、JSON。本文为您提供MaxCompute SQL支持的复杂类型函数的命令格式、参数说明及示例,指导您使用复杂类型函数完成开发。MaxCompute SQL支持的复杂类型...

Failed to parse response as json format

Failed to parse response as json format.Response:?xml version='1.0' encoding='UTF-8'?返回的格式是 xml,而期望返回是 json;在请求的时候可以设置参数 formatType 为 json。公共参数:Format 返回值的类型,支持 JSON 与 XML,默认为 ...

JSON

scalar(json_parse(value_string),'$.owners[1]')from json_table_3+-+|_col0|+-+|张三|select json_extract_scalar(json_obj.json_col,'$.DEFAULT.submask')from(select json_extract(json_parse(value_string),'$.clusterMap')as json_...

导出和导入动态配置

动态配置文件格式 动态配置文件每一行对应一个完整的配置 JSON 结构,配置类中可包含多个属性,多个配置类的 JSON 数据以换行符分隔。内容格式如下:{"region":"Alipay","appName":"testModel","name":"测试配置","resourceId":...

创建源表

jsonParser='default' 示例:create table property(json varchar,jsonType varchar,gmtCreate as to_timestamp(cast(json_value(json,'$.gmtCreate')as bigint)),deviceName as json_value(json,'$.deviceName'),productKey as json_value...

JSON函数

返回结果如下:+-+|json_extract('[10,20,[30,40]]','$.1')|+-+|20|+-+JSON_SIZE json_size(json,json_path)命令说明:从JSON中返回 json_path 指定JSON对象或JSON数组的大小。说明 若 json_path 指向的不是JSON对象或者JSON数组时,返回0...

MaxCompute JSON类型使用指南

JSON类型使用 说明 当前在新版的MaxCompute项目中,odps.sql.type.json.enable 参数默认为true,而在存量MaxCompute项目中,odps.sql.type.json.enable 参数默认为false。因此,若您是存量MaxCompute项目,在使用JSON数据类型时,需执行 ...

支持的文件格式

这篇文档介绍DLA支持的文件格式。​CREATE EXTERNAL TABLE IF NOT EXISTS test_avro(L_ORDERKEY INT,L_...counties(Name string,BoundaryShape binary)ROW FORMAT SERDE 'com.esri.hadoop.hive.serde.EsriJsonSerDe' STORED AS INPUTFORMAT '...

存储格式与SerDe

STORED AS JSON 数据文件的存储格式为JSON(Esri ArcGIS的地理JSON数据文件除外)。通过 STORED AS 指定文件格式的同时,还可以根据具体文件的特点,指定SerDe和特殊列分隔符等,详细地使用方法将在各类型文件格式示例中为您讲解。

日志实时入仓快速入门

`offset` BIGINT NOT NULL METADATA,`partition` BIGINT NOT NULL METADATA,`timestamp` TIMESTAMP METADATA,`date` AS CAST(`timestamp` AS DATE),`country` AS JSON_VALUE(`address`,'$.country'))WITH('connector'='kafka','properties....

jsoncpp

osal_aos cplusplus 常用配置 API说明 第三方库 API 对应放在头文件中,每个头文件的都包含了中函数的详细解释 value 相关 class JSON_API Value class JSON_API Path class JSON_API ValueIteratorBase class JSON_API ...

表单上传

base64.b64encode(json.dumps(policy).encode('utf-8')).decode(),'ossAccessKeyId':access_key_id,'signature':signature,'host':host,'dir':upload_dir#可以在这里再自行追加其他参数 } return json.dumps(response)JavaScript const ...

JSON函数

ARRAY_APPEND JSON_ARRAY_INSERT JSON_INSERT JSON_MERGE JSON_MERGE_PATCH JSON_MERGE_PRESERVE JSON_REMOVE JSON_REPLACE JSON_SET JSON_UNQUOTE JSON属性 JSON_DEPTH JSON_LENGTH JSON_TYPE JSON_VALID JSON工具 JSON_PRETTY JSON_...

SPL与SQL的使用场景对照

parse(Time,'%Y-%m-%d%H:%i')字段提取 正则提取 select cast(Status as BIGINT)as Status,date_parse(Time,'%Y-%m-%d%H:%i')AS Time JSON提取 select cast(Status as BIGINT)as Status,date_parse(Time,'%Y-%m-%d%H:%i')AS Time 正则提取:...

UDAF和UDTF动态参数说明

SELECT my_json_tuple(json)as exceptions,a,b FROM jsons;下面这个SQL会出现运行时错误,因为别名个数与实际输出个数不符。注意编译时无法发现这个错误。SELECT my_json_tuple(json,'a','b')as exceptions,a,b,c FROM jsons;当本文介绍的...

Python 3 UDTF读取MaxCompute资源示例

list,生成dict"""def_init_(self):import json cache_file=get_cache_file('test_json.txt')self.my_dict=json.load(cache_file)cache_file.close()records=list(get_cache_table('table_resource1'))for record in records:self.my_dict...

基于OSS文件自动推断建表

开通OSS服务 创建存储空间 上传数据文件 OSS的my_new_table目录下上传json1.txt、json2.txt、json3.txt三个文件,json1.txt、json2.txt两个文件的结构相同。json1.txt、json2.txt、json3.txt存储的数据分别如下所示。{"id":123,"name":...

JSON数据列展开

'$.a')AS_col3,json_extract(t.n,'$.b')AS_col4 FROM(SELECT cast(json_extract('{"x":[{"a":1,"b":2},{"a":3,"b":4}]}','$.x')AS array<JSON>)AS array_1,cast(json_extract('{"x":[{"a":5,"b":6},{"a":7,"b":8},{"a":9,"b":10},{"a":11,...

查询和分析JSON日志的常见问题

and response:SUCCESS|SELECT item,count(1)AS cnt FROM(SELECT orderinfo FROM log,unnest(cast(json_extract(request,'$.param.orders')AS array(json)))AS t(orderinfo)),unnest(cast(json_extract(orderinfo,'$.commodity')AS array...

Readable Protobuf

PolarDB MySQL版 支持Readable Protobuf功能,即针对存储在数据库中的经过Protobuf序列化的Blob类型的字段,您可以在对应的字段上配置Protobuf schema,并通过可视化函数 PROTO_TO_JSON(blob_field)来读取数据。同时,您也可以使用 JSON_...

JSON_VALUE

使用JSON_VALUE函数,从JSON字符串中提取指定路径的表达式。使用限制 仅实时计算引擎VVR 3.0.0及以上版本支持JSON_VALUE函数。语法 VARCHAR JSON_VALUE(VARCHAR content,VARCHAR path)入参 参数 数据类型 说明 content VARCHAR 需要解析的...

流式入库

schema).as("json")).select("json.*")val query=lines.writeStream.outputMode("append").format("delta").option("checkpointLocation",checkpointLocation).start(targetDir)query.awaitTermination()SQL bash streaming-sql-master ...

加入共享带宽

BandwidthPackageId(params['bandwidth_package_id'])response=self.client.do_action_with_exception(request)response_json=json.loads(response)return response_json except ServerException as e:ExceptionHandler.server_exception(e...

同账号同地域VPC间互通

query_param('Filter.1.Value.1',instance_id)response=self.client.do_action_with_exception(request)response_json=json.loads(response)return response_json except ServerException as e:ExceptionHandler.server_exception(e)except...

文件分析

格式:strip_outer_array:true json_root 当导入数据格式为JSON时,可以通过 json_root 指定JSON数据的根节点。SelectDB将通过 json_root 抽取根节点的元素进行解析。默认为空。格式:json_root:$.RECORDS path_partition_keys 指定文件...

绑定和解绑EIP

NatGatewayId(nat_gateway_id)response=client.do_action_with_exception(request)response_json=json.loads(response)return response_json except ServerException as e:ExceptionHandler.server_exception(e)except ClientException as ...

Debezium

debezium-json.encode.decimal-as-plain-number 否 false Boolean 参数取值如下:true:所有DECIMAL类型的数据保持原状,不使用科学计数法表示,例:0.000000027表示为0.000000027。false:所有DECIMAL类型的数据,使用科学计数法表示,...

JSON函数

Tablestore SQL的JSON函数遵循MySQL 5.7的语法。本文介绍Tablestore SQL支持的JSON函数以及JSON函数的用法。支持的JSON函数 目前Tablestore SQL支持的JSON函数请参见下表。JSON函数 说明->>从JSON文档中解出某一路径对应的文档并取消引用...

UNNEST子句

number:[49,50,45,47,50]查询和分析语句*|SELECT sum(a)AS sum FROM log,UNNEST(cast(json_parse(number)as array(bigint)))AS t(a)查询和分析结果 示例3 将 number 字段的值(array类型)展开为多行单列形式,并对各个值进行分组统计。...

Entity

[1,2,3]ArrayList object 例如:{},{"a":1,"b":[1,2,3]} HashMap 如果使用getObjectValue()和fromObjectValue()不能满足您的需求,建议可考虑使用getStringValue()和fromStringValue()方法、并结合内置的JSON处理工具对序列化后的字符...

JSON和JSONB类型

JSON和JSONB介绍 近年来随着移动端应用的普及,应用埋点、用户标签计算等场景开始诞生,为了更好的支撑这场景,越来越多的大数据系统开始使用半结构化格式来存储此类数据,以获得更加灵活的开发和处理。常用的半结构化类型为JSON和JSONB...

DataX同步数据

计算类型 本教程中上传的资源(datax.json)用于DataX代码任务中引用,因此选择 无归属引擎。计算类型用于定义资源文件是否需要上传至计算引擎的存储层。Dataphin系统支持的计算类型包括 MaxCompute、Flink 和 无归属引擎,适用场景说明...

基于GitHub公开事件数据集的离线实时一体化实践

JSON_OBJECT(col,'$.repo.id')AS BIGINT)AS repo_id,GET_JSON_OBJECT(col,'$.repo.name')AS repo_name,CAST(GET_JSON_OBJECT(col,'$.org.id')AS BIGINT)AS org_id,GET_JSON_OBJECT(col,'$.org.login')AS org_login,GET_JSON_OBJECT(col,'$....

基于GitHub公开事件数据集的离线实时一体化实践

JSON_OBJECT(col,'$.repo.id')AS BIGINT)AS repo_id,GET_JSON_OBJECT(col,'$.repo.name')AS repo_name,CAST(GET_JSON_OBJECT(col,'$.org.id')AS BIGINT)AS org_id,GET_JSON_OBJECT(col,'$.org.login')AS org_login,GET_JSON_OBJECT(col,'$....

Routine Load

json_root-H"json_root:$.RECORDS"当导入数据格式为JSON时,可以通过 json_root 指定JSON数据的根节点。SelectDB将通过 json_root 抽取根节点的元素进行解析。默认为空。send_batch_parallelism 无 指定设置发送批处理数据的并行度,如果...

使用限制

STRENGTH()不支持 JSON函数 函数 是否支持使用列存索引功能 JSON_ARRAY()不支持 JSON_ARRAY_APPEND()不支持 JSON_ARRAY_INSERT()不支持 JSON_CONTAINS_PATH()不支持 JSON_INSERT()不支持 JSON_MERGE()不支持 JSON_MERGE_PATCH()不支持 JSON...

媒资管理

accept_format('JSON')response=json.loads(clt.do_action_with_exception(request))return response try:clt=init_vod_client()delInfo=delete_image(clt)print(json.dumps(delInfo,ensure_ascii=False,indent=4))except Exception as e:...
< 1 2 3 4 ... 200 >
共有200页 跳转至: GO
新人特惠 爆款特惠 最新活动 免费试用